The WAYNE 1 HP Submersible Cast Iron and Stainless Steel Sump Pump is an excellent choice for those looking to keep their basements dry during heavy water flow. With a powerful 1-horsepower motor, it can pump up to 6,100 gallons per hour, making it ideal for handling large volumes of water from rain or melting snow. The maximum lifting height of 10 feet ensures it can effectively move water out of deep sump pits.
The pump's construction is noteworthy, featuring corrosion-resistant stainless steel and cast-iron components that promise durability and long life, even in tough conditions. The vertical float switch, tested to 1 million cycles, adds to its reliability and ease of use. Another plus is the top suction design, which reduces the likelihood of air lock and clogging, enhancing the pump's efficiency and performance. The product also comes with a 5-year warranty, indicating the manufacturer's confidence in its quality.
However, there are a few drawbacks. The pump lacks a battery backup, which means it won't operate during a power outage unless you have an alternative power source. Additionally, while it is relatively easy to install, some users might find the weight of 19 pounds a bit cumbersome. The WAYNE 1 HP Sump Pump is a durable, efficient, and quiet option for those in need of a reliable sump pump, provided they have a stable power supply.
The WAYNE CDU800 1/2 HP Submersible Sump Pump is designed to keep your basement dry with a powerful 1/2 horsepower motor capable of pumping up to 5,100 gallons per hour (GPH). Its robust construction includes a corrosion-resistant epoxy-coated steel motor housing and cast iron volute, ensuring durability even in tough conditions. The pump's top suction design helps to prevent air locks and minimize clogging, making it efficient and easy to install without the need for extra drilling.
Additionally, the integrated vertical float switch has been tested to perform up to 1 million cycles, indicating long-lasting reliability. This model is designed for indoor use only and operates quietly, making it suitable for residential basements where noise could be a concern. However, it does not come with a battery backup, which could be a significant drawback during power outages.
Weighing 12 pounds and measuring 9 x 9 x 12 inches, the pump is compact and easy to handle. Proudly assembled in the USA, it also comes with a three-year warranty, offering peace of mind regarding its quality and performance. This sump pump is a strong contender for those looking for a durable, efficient, and quiet solution for basement water removal, though those needing a battery backup may need to consider additional options.
The Basement Watchdog Big Combo CONNECT Model CITS-50 is a solid choice for those in need of a primary and battery backup sump pump system. Its ½ HP PSC motor is energy-efficient, which could lead to reduced electricity bills. With impressive flow rates—3,540 GPH at a 10 ft lift and 4,400 GPH at 0 ft lift for the primary pump; and 1,850 GPH at 10 ft for the backup—it effectively handles significant water removal, making it suitable for various basements.
One standout feature is its WiFi capability, allowing for 24/7 monitoring and real-time alerts via an app, text, or email. This provides peace of mind, especially during heavy rain or potential flooding situations. The alarm system and warning lights also aid in easy maintenance, a big plus for those who aren’t particularly handy.
In terms of materials, the cast iron primary pump ensures durability, while the ABS backup system adds some resilience. However, the unit weighs 27 pounds, which might be a bit cumbersome for some users during installation. The 25-foot maximum lifting height is decent, but those with particularly deep basements may find it limits their options. Additionally, the CONNECT module for full WiFi functionality is sold separately, which could be an extra expense. This product suits homeowners looking for a dependable and smart sump pump system, especially in areas prone to flooding.
